Назад к вопросам
101ХР
Junior — Middle
83
Как была организована команда и распределены роли в проекте?
Компании, где спрашивали
Ответ от нейросети
sobes.tech AI
Организация команды и распределение ролей в проекте зависит от его масштаба и специфики, но обычно включает следующие роли:
- Руководитель проекта (Project Manager) — отвечает за планирование, контроль сроков и коммуникацию с заказчиком.
- Технический лидер (Tech Lead) — определяет архитектуру, стандарты кодирования и технические решения.
- Разработчики — пишут код, реализуют функциональность.
- Тестировщики (QA) — проверяют качество продукта.
- Аналитики — собирают требования и формируют техническое задание.
В небольших командах один человек может совмещать несколько ролей.
Пример распределения в C/C++ проекте:
- Senior разработчик — отвечает за архитектуру и сложные модули.
- Junior разработчики — реализуют отдельные функции и исправляют баги.
- QA инженер — пишет тесты и проводит ручное тестирование.
Важно, чтобы роли были четко определены, а коммуникация внутри команды была налажена для эффективной работы.